H6346
- Original: פּחה - Transliteration: Pechah - Phonetic: peh-khaw' - Definition: 1. governor - Origin: of foreign origin - TWOT entry: 1757 - Part(s) of speech: Noun Masculine - Strong's: Of foreign origin; a prefect (of a city or small district): - captain deputy governor. Total KJV Occurrences: 28 • captain, 2
